By finishing 3rd in his keirin quarter-final, Rayan Helal advances to the semi-finals of these Tokyo Games.
Bronze medalist in the team sprint five days earlier, Rayan Helal returned to the Izu Velodrome on Sunday. Engaged in the keirin track cycling event, the resident of the US Créteil retains his chances of winning a second medal in these Games from Tokyo. The French rider finished his quarter-final in 3rd position behind Briton Jason Kenny and Colombian Quintero Chavarro. We had to finish in the top four of this six-loop race, pitting six competitors against each other.

The women’s omnium got off to a spectacular start with two falls in the last laps of the scratch race. More than ten runners fell on the floor of the Izu Velodrome! And among them we count the French Clara Copponi as well as the title holder, the Briton Laura Kenny. It is well known that the misfortune of some makes the happiness of others. Victorious of the event, the American Jennifer Valente scored 40 points before the second event which will be the tempo race.
